Apple is reportedly considering resuming preparations for manufacturing its iPads in India, encouraged by the government’s efforts to attract more supply chains into the country. The company is said to be looking for a new manufacturing partner after facing obstacles with its previous attempt with China’s BYD. According to sources, a senior government official revealed that Apple has ambitious plans for the Indian market over the next 2-3 years, including the prospect of manufacturing laptops and desktops in the country.

Last year, Apple redirected its iPad product development focus to Vietnam due to challenges in setting up manufacturing operations in India. However, current indications suggest a shift back towards India. In addition to iPads, Apple is scaling up its production capabilities for iPhones and planning to enhance the manufacturing of components for AirPod wireless charging cases through Jabil in India.

The tech giant is also gearing up to initiate production of TWS (true wireless stereo) AirPods in India from early next year. Parts of the wireless charging cases for AirPods are already being produced in Pune through Jabil. The company may extend its production collaborations to Foxconn as well, as it aims to address both export and domestic demand.

Apple’s goal is to expand its manufacturing footprint in India with an ambitious target of manufacturing 25% of all iPhones in the country over the next 3-4 years. This marks a significant increase from the current 14% production level. As part of this strategy, Apple is working on building a network of local vendors to reduce its dependence on Chinese suppliers.

The company’s efforts to localize production in India have been gaining momentum, with exports of over $2 billion worth of iPhones in the first two months of the current financial year. Apple has also been successful in capturing a substantial share of smartphone revenue in India, outperforming rival Samsung in terms of shipments and market share.
